Installation Instructions for T-Connector Adapter for Ford Transit Connect
Part Numbers:
- 118585
Tools Required:
- 6mm Hex Wrench
- Phillips Head Screwdriver
- Test Probe
- Wire Cutters
Step-by-Step Instructions:
-
Remove the Taillight Assemblies:
- Open the rear door.
- Using a 6mm hex wrench, remove the two bolts securing the taillight housing.
- Carefully pry the taillight housing away from the vehicle, avoiding damage to the alignment tabs.
- Repeat for the passenger side.
-
Locate the Taillight Wiring Harness:
- On both the driver and passenger sides, locate the vehicle’s taillight wiring harness.
- Separate the connectors, ensuring not to damage the locking tabs. Clean the connector surfaces to remove dirt.
-
Install the Driver-Side T-Connector:
- Connect the T-Connector harness containing the yellow wire between the driver’s side connectors.
-
Install the Passenger-Side T-Connector:
- Repeat step 3 for the passenger side using the T-Connector with the green wire.
-
Route the Wiring Across the Vehicle:
- On the driver’s side, locate the black plug above the door hinge and remove it to expose a hole.
- Route the wires containing the green and red wires through the hole, down behind the bumper, across to the passenger side, and back up through the corresponding hole.
Warning:
- Avoid routing near hot pipes, heat shields, the fuel tank, or areas where the wire may be pinched or broken.
-
Connect the Green and Red Wires:
- On the passenger side, plug the green and red wires into the corresponding connectors on the T-Connector harness.
-
Store the 4-Flat Connector:
- Route the 4-flat connector into the driver’s side storage compartment.
- Store it there when not in use.
-
Ground the White Wire:
- Locate an existing ground stud near the driver’s side.
- Loosen the bolt, place the eyelet on the stud, and retighten the bolt.
-
Connect the Power Wire:
- Disconnect the vehicle’s negative (-) battery cable.
- Attach the yellow fuse holder to the positive (+) battery cable using the provided ring terminal.
- Connect the black 12-gauge wire to the other end of the fuse holder using the yellow butt connector.
-
Route the Power Wire:
- Route the black wire through the engine compartment to the battery, avoiding areas where the wire may be pinched or damaged.
-
Complete Power Connections:
- Connect the black power wire from the T-Connector’s black box to the routed black wire using the yellow butt connector.
- Reconnect the vehicle’s negative (-) battery cable and insert the 15-amp fuse into the fuse holder.
-
Mount the Black Box:
- Clean a flat area behind the driver’s side taillight assembly with a mixture of rubbing alcohol and water.
- Mount the black box using the provided double-sided tape.
-
Secure the Wiring:
- Use the silver tape provided to secure the green and red wires along cleaned areas of the vehicle.
- Notch and reinstall the black plugs removed earlier to accommodate the wires.
-
Reinstall the Taillight Assemblies:
- Reinstall the taillights removed in step 1.
-
Test the Installation:
- Test the T-Connector installation with a test light or trailer.
- Reset the vehicle’s electrical system by temporarily removing the key from the ignition.
Specifications:
- Max. stop/turn light: 1 per side (2.1 amps)
- Max. tail lights: (5.6 amps)
Safety Notes:
- Overloading circuits can cause fires. Do not exceed the towing manufacturer’s rating or the unit specifications.
- Always follow all safety precautions and use safety glasses during installation.
